Output 104026fdd6976de826071a734c5467daf0a2683c0ca2ea8febbf57eacc479ea3:10

value
2498000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1fcec50c6216d43b1c33b36216244e0998b8060 OP_EQUAL
address
3NHvx7QJJCpVurENQUNLBfTQQfCKcBVH2a
transaction
104026fdd6976de826071a734c5467daf0a2683c0ca2ea8febbf57eacc479ea3
spent
true